Below is a list of best universities in Connecticut ranked based on their research performance in Tax Law. A graph of 12K citations received by 462 academic papers made by 5 universities in Connecticut was used to calculate publications' ratings, which then were adjusted for release dates and added to final scores.

We don't distinguish between undergraduate and graduate programs nor do we adjust for current majors offered. You can find information about granted degrees on a university page but always double-check with the university website.
